What is a survey associate?

Survey Associates are professionals who assist in designing, administering, and analyzing surveys for research or data collection purposes. They help ensure that surveys are conducted accurately and efficiently, often handling tasks like preparing survey materials, collecting responses, and maintaining data integrity. Survey Associates may work in a variety of fields including market research, social science, or public opinion polling. Their work supports organizations in gathering meaningful insights to inform decisions or policy.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a survey associate?

To thrive as a Survey Associate,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a background in statistics or social sciences, often supported by a relevant bachelor's degree. Proficiency in survey software like Qualtrics or SurveyMonkey, as well as data analysis tools such as Excel or SPSS, is typically required. Excellent communication, organizational skills, and the ability to work collaboratively help Survey Associates excel in gathering and interpreting accurate data. These competencies ensure the effective design, execution, and analysis of surveys, leading to reliable insights for decision-making.

What are some common challenges survey associates face when collecting data in the field?

Survey Associates often encounter challenges such as gaining participant cooperation, ensuring accurate data recording, and adapting to unexpected field conditions. It's important to approach respondents with professionalism and empathy to build trust and encourage honest participation. Additionally, Survey Associates must be detail-oriented and flexible, as fieldwork can involve changing schedules or travel. Support from team leads and clear communication within the team help address these challenges and maintain data quality.

MasTec Civil is currently hiring for a Survey Party Chief in Columbia, SC!

The Survey Party Chief will lead the field survey crew and be responsible for the organization, efficiency, and accuracy of work performed and data obtained.

Responsibilities
  • Oversees the development and execution of construction, right-of-way, control, topographic, and/or other related survey duties.
  • Determines appropriate surveying techniques to be used on each project.
  • Collaborates with utility companies to ensure surveys are properly executed for public streets and easements.
  • Gathers survey data using global positioning systems (GPS) and other surveying tools to map areas and measure angles, distances, and elevations.
  • Analyzes plans, plats, and legal documents to appropriately plan and schedule work.
  • Defines boundaries for property and rights of way.
  • Draft reports, descriptions, and other documentation for all surveys performed.
  • Ensures final maps display a comprehensive and accurate description of the field survey.
  • Ensures the work of all crew members meets standards and that assigned tasks are completed in a timely manner.
  • Completes any surveying tasks crew members are unable to complete.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.
